Problem Cygwin + subversin : checkout -> svn: Can't recode string

Hello,
 
I use Cygwin on my windows server.
I have installed with the cygwin setup : sshd, subversion (and a lot of
package i need)
 
I use TortoiseSVN for my client computers, and checkout, commit, update
works well.
 
But in my server under cygwin, i attempt to make a checkout :
svn checkout file:///cygdrive/c/RepositorySVN/ABC/
 
and that’s my result :
A  ABC/doc/documents/Idee
A  ABC/doc/documents/Idee/Idee  Portail
A  ABC/doc/documents/Idee/Idee  Portail/Liste Portails exemples.txt
svn: Can't recode string
 
I think there is an encoding problem or a charset problem but i doesn’t
known a solution !
(because the problem is with files or directory wich have got an “é” or
“è”)
